The Marvelous Land of Oz #8
In "Part Eight" of *The Marvelous Land of Oz*, Glinda confronts the sorceress Mombi in a spellbound showdown that unravels a long-hidden truth: the true ruler of Oz, Ozma, has been living as the boy Tip all along. With Skottie Young’s whimsical art and Jean-François Beaulieu’s vibrant colors bringing the magical realm to life, this issue marks a pivotal moment in the journey of a kingdom long in need of its rightful queen. Glinda defeats Mombi in a battle of magic and forces her to reveal that Ozma, the true heir to the throne of Oz, was transformed into the boy Tip. Reluctant to give up his life as a boy, Tip eventually agrees to be changed back into Ozma, and General Jinjur is removed from power.
